Understanding Tailored Solutions


Tailored solutions refer to customized strategies, tools, or services designed to meet the unique needs of a business. Unlike one-size-fits-all approaches, tailored solutions consider the specific context, goals, and challenges of an organization. This customization can lead to improved efficiency, better resource allocation, and ultimately, greater success.


Why Tailored Solutions Matter


  1. Increased Efficiency

    Tailored solutions streamline processes, reducing time and effort spent on tasks. For example, a company that implements a customized project management tool can enhance collaboration and communication among team members.


  2. Cost-Effectiveness

    By focusing on specific needs, businesses can avoid unnecessary expenses associated with generic solutions. Tailored solutions ensure that resources are allocated effectively, maximizing return on investment.


  3. Enhanced Flexibility

    Tailored solutions can adapt to changing business environments. As your organization grows or shifts direction, customized tools and strategies can evolve to meet new demands.


  4. Improved Employee Satisfaction

    When employees have access to tools that fit their needs, they are more likely to feel empowered and engaged. This can lead to higher job satisfaction and lower turnover rates.


Identifying Your Business Needs


Before implementing tailored solutions, it’s crucial to identify your business needs. Here are some steps to help you assess your requirements:


Conduct a Needs Assessment


A thorough needs assessment involves gathering data on your current processes, challenges, and goals. This can be done through:


  • Surveys and Interviews: Engage employees at all levels to understand their pain points and suggestions for improvement.

  • Process Mapping: Visualize workflows to identify bottlenecks and inefficiencies.

  • Performance Metrics: Analyze key performance indicators (KPIs) to pinpoint areas needing attention.


Define Clear Objectives


Once you have a clear understanding of your needs, define specific objectives for your tailored solutions. These objectives should be:


  • SMART: Specific, Measurable, Achievable, Relevant, and Time-bound.

  • Aligned with Business Goals: Ensure that your objectives support the overall mission and vision of your organization.

Measuring Success


Once tailored solutions are implemented, it’s essential to measure their effectiveness. Here are some methods to evaluate success:


Track Key Performance Indicators


Identify KPIs that align with your objectives and regularly monitor them. This could include:


  • Productivity Metrics: Measure output per employee or team.

  • Cost Savings: Analyze reductions in operational costs due to implemented solutions.

  • Employee Satisfaction: Conduct surveys to gauge employee engagement and satisfaction with new tools.


Gather Feedback


Solicit feedback from employees on the effectiveness of tailored solutions. This can help identify areas for further improvement and ensure that solutions remain relevant.
